Transaction 643a0bd73e49d9d1b2ace80fb148971403033189b69e77b78ca40cba2398bb14
2 Input
2 Outputs
- 643a0bd73e49d9d1b2ace80fb148971403033189b69e77b78ca40cba2398bb14:0
- 643a0bd73e49d9d1b2ace80fb148971403033189b69e77b78ca40cba2398bb14:1
value 6477
address 14PjzvqeHcdDN9G4VQmPwouQU2VZCkzpWu
value 1983109
address 1HpCtYdY6gUXygxkp5fVccQVwkXSfYGLE2